Analytical Methods in Motorsport
Růžička, Bronislav ; Dočkal, Aleš (referee) ; Čejka, Václav (referee) ; Karpíšek, Zdeněk (referee) ; Mazůrek, Ivan (advisor)
This dissertation is focused on proposal for simplified data analyze approach for sport-car vehicle dynamic evaluation with relationship to possibility for qualified estimation of set-up parameters influence for overall vehicle performance. In common practice can be usual overlapping effect caused by concurrent changes of car setup elements if performed in the same moment with resulting in not correct or hardly definable process determination for evaluation and decision about next steps in car development. For analyze of these multidimensional data is then chosen process with approach by Linear Regression Model (LRM). In dissertation is proposed basic philosophy with concern on specificity of car vehicle dynamics, performed experiment with defined inputs including analyze and interpretation method of obtained outputs. This methodic take into account also possibility for general application of multidimensional data analyses not only in motorsport, but as well for dynamic behavior diagnostics of technical systems where finding of optimal running condition depends on multi-parametric setup whose combination must reflect often changes of outer conditions too.

Turbochargers in motorsport
Chovanec, Stanislav ; Zubík, Martin (referee) ; Knotek, Jiří (advisor)
This bachelor’s thesis deals with the use of turbochargers in motorsport, latest used technologies and regulations for each competition. Furthermore, the thesis compare technologies used in relation to civilian use.

Sport cars BMW - from history to present
Bartoš, Martin ; Svída, David (referee) ; Dundálek, Radim (advisor)
This thesis describes a chronological overview of the most important sport cars BMW from the begining of the company up to the present, which influenced motorsport in a way. The first part describes the history of the BMW car company. The next part of the thesis focuses on individual cars. The structual design of every model is described, eventually marked different unconventional construction. Next, there is a short part about succeses in races. Finally the most important technical specifications are mentioned.

Engine modification for racing application
Fried, Tomáš ; Janoušek, Michal (referee) ; Drápal, Lubomír (advisor)
This bachelor’s thesis deals with modifying a stock engine for racing application. The thesis briefly describes the regulations of the championship FIA CEZ Division 4 and rival powertrains. Next, it analyses the stock engine and two variants of modifications. The last chapter offers further possible modifications to the engine.
